Willard R. Windt

former EPSD teacher

Willard R. Windt, 86, of Allentown, died peacefully Sept. 20, 2025, while residing at DevonHouse Senior Living. Born in Wilkes-Barre, he was the son of the late Willard L. and Anna M. (Maza) Windt.

He was a graduate of Nanticoke High School and Millersville State College.

He was an industrial arts teacher for the East Penn School District for many years and introduced taped lessons of industrial arts classes.

He was a former member of the Emmaus Lions Club and member of PSEA, NEA and was a friend of Mr. Bill.

He is survived by his brother, James F. and his wife, Dorothy; nieces, Jennifer and her husband, Duane Gutshall, Kimberly and her husband, Eric Dost; nephew, Matthew and his wife, Erin; great-nieces, Ashley, Jordyn, Courtney; great-nephew, Andrew; step-brother-in-law, Ronald Wolfe.

He was predeceased by his stepmother, Dorothy S. Stackhouse; stepsister, Joan Wolfe.

His family would like to thank the staff and residents of DevonHouse Senior Living for the support and friendship during his stay there.

Services will be private at the convenience of the family. Arrangements are entrusted to Schantz Funeral Home, P.C., Emmaus.
